Warning Signs You Need Industrial Dehumidification
Catching moisture damage early can save you money and prevent bigger problems down the line. Here are some common warning sign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it could be a sign of excess moisture. This can be especially true in areas like basements or crawl spaces where moisture tends to accumulate.
Water Stains or Warping
Water stains or warping on walls or floors can be a sign of moisture damage. If left unchecked, this can lead to more serious problems like mold growth or structural damage.
Damp Feeling in the Air
A damp feeling in the air can be a sign of excess moisture. This can be especially true in areas with high humidity or where water has been present.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of moisture damage. This can be especially true in areas with high humidity or where water has been present.
Mold Growth
Mold growth can be a sign of excess moisture. This can be especially true in areas like bathrooms or kitchens where moisture tends to accumulate.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of moisture damage. This can be especially true in areas with high humidity or where water has been present.

Industrial Dehumidification Cost in Muskogee, OK
The cost of Industrial Dehumidification can vary depending on the severity of the moisture dam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Muskogee, OK.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Dehumidification and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of moisture damage, size of affected area, local conditions |
| Equipment rental and setup | $100 – $500 | Equipment type and rental duration |
| Moisture testing and assessment | $200 – $1,000 | Complexity of assessment, equipment used |
| Mold remediation | $500 – $2,000 | Extent of mold growth, size of affected area |
| Water damage repair | $1,000 – $5,000 | Severity of water damage, size of affected area |
| Follow-up inspections and maintenance | $100 – $500 | Frequency and scope of inspections |
